China Demonstrates Quantum Encryption By Hosting a Video Call. This reads like pure science fiction:
Pan’s team first established a connection and generated a secure key between a ground station in Xinglong and the Micius satellite as it passed overhead, orbiting about 500 kilometers above Earth. [...]
Next, the Chinese team waited for Micius to pass over Vienna, where their collaborators at the Austria Academy of Sciences were waiting to also receive the key from the satellite. Then, with the keys in hand, the groups initiated a video conference and used those keys to encrypt the video data through a standard VPN protocol.
